How they compare
Netherlands currently reports 10.42 Million euro against 2.46 Million euro in Lithuania, a difference of 7.96 Million euro.
That makes Netherlands's figure about 4.2 times Lithuania's.
Across all 7 years both countries report, Netherlands has been ahead every year.
Lithuania ranks 24th and Netherlands ranks 21st of 32 countries.
Netherlands has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
